Ukrainian President’s Advisor offered his resignation

Advisor of the Ukrainian President statement that the Russian missile was pre-shot by the country air defense system before it fell on the residential building created a social and political imbroglio for Kyiv.

Kyiv, 18 January 2023 (GNP):  Advisor of the Ukrainian President Vladimir Zelenskyy offered his resignation after his statement that a Russian missile hitting an apartment building in Dnipro was pre-hit by the Ukrainian air defense system before it gutted the residential building, killing at least 44 people on the spot.

Oleksly Arestovych, the advisor to President Zelenskyy, said on his YouTube channel that this missile was shot down by the state air defense system before hitting the targeted building.

However, the debris of the hit missile fell on the residential building, killing 44 civilians there.

After this statement, the Russian officials blamed Kyiv for deliberately hitting their residential building and putting the blame for this destruction on Moscow for getting worldwide sympathy for Ukraine.

The Ukrainian advisor Oleksly Arestovych called this a fundamental error and offered his resignation to the president.

However, President Zelenskyy did not comment on this resignation. Oleksly Arestovych provides regular updates about the Ukraine war through his YouTube channel and on other social media platforms.

This political and social imbroglio caught both the Ukrainian government and Ukrainian advisor Oleksly Arestovych.

The Ukrainian military and government officials said that this building was hit by a Russian Kh-22 missile that’s shooting down capacity, which their country does not have.

Some Ukrainian parliamentarians demanded the immediate dismissal of Oleksly Arestovych from the position of president’s advisor.

They accused him that such ruckus behavior would only strengthen Russian propaganda.

Dmitry Peskov, the spokesperson for the Russian government, blamed Ukraine for killing their civilian to get political and social mileage for them. He said that Moscow never targets civilian installations and buildings in war.

Meanwhile, Ukrainian officials said there is less chance of anybody being alive in this destroyed residential building.

Other Ukrainian cities, Kyiv, Kharkiv, and Odesa, were also barraged by the Russian missiles along with Dnipro in their Sunday strikes.
